Solution Overview

Problem

Existing tumble dryers face challenges in efficient maintenance procedures, as the heat pump components are not easily removable or replaceable, leading to difficulties in maintenance and repair, especially when requiring central workshop facilities.

Innovation Solution

The heat pump components, including a condenser, compressor, and evaporator, are arranged as a removable unit with a common insulating shell and wheels, allowing for easy replacement and improved energy efficiency, with the entire unit being designed for central maintenance and efficient space utilization.

AI summary

The present disclosure relates to a tumble dryer (1) comprising a housing (2), a rotatable drum (11) in the housing being accessible from a front side (3) of the housing, and a fan arrangement (13) for producing a flow of process air through the drum. A heat pump is used for drying the process air before it enters the drum, the heat pump comprising a condenser (19), a compressor (17), and an evaporator (15). The condenser 19 the compressor (17), and the evaporator (15) are arranged as components in a heat pump unit (43), wherein the heat pump unit is removable from the remainder of the tumble dryer (1) through an opening in the rear side of the tumble dryer housing without separating the components. This facilitates for instance service of the tumble dryer.
